#b1d838 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b1d838 is composed of 69.4% red, 84.7%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.1%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 74.6 degrees, a saturation of 67.2% and a lightness of 53.3%. #b1d838 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#63b100.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#b1d838 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b1d838 has RGB values of R:177, G:216,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 11655224.

Hex triplet b1d838 #b1d838
RGB Decimal 177, 216, 56 rgb(177,216,56)
RGB Percent 69.4, 84.7, 22 rgb(69.4%,84.7%,22%)
CMYK 18, 0, 74, 15
HSL 74.6°, 67.2, 53.3 hsl(74.6,67.2%,53.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 74.6°, 74.1, 84.7
Web Safe 99cc33 #99cc33
CIE-LAB 81.151, -33.727, 69.543
XYZ 43.401, 58.744, 12.793
xyY 0.378, 0.511, 58.744
CIE-LCH 81.151, 77.29, 115.873
CIE-LUV 81.151, -18.521, 85.142
Hunter-Lab 76.645, -33.051, 43.755
Binary 10110001, 11011000, 00111000

Shades and Tints of #b1d838

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0e03 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.
